All anemones can sting fish and coral, but it’s a relatively safe type. It lives in the sand bed so don’t try to place it on your rocks as it will keep moving. Looks like it could be a pretty one too once it colors up. Great deal if they charged you for a condylactis. You should be able to see white spots under the oral disc to confirm identification.
